Note: We have organized the cemeteries in our Gazetteer based on a problem that we had while working on our own genealogy. As an example and without specifying the cemeteries involved, we found an ancestor that we believed to have been buried in one cemetery had actually been buried elsewhere.
We discovered that his burial plans had changed at the last moment and the family had scrambled to make new arrangements. By looking at nearby cemeteries, the surrounding communities and in newspapers of the period, we were finally able to locate his burial site.
Should you find yourself in the same situation, we hope that our Gazetteer helps you discover your lost ancestor.
The Location of the South Cemetery ...
We are using the following GPS coordinates (latitude and longitude) for the South Cemetery:
42.7432, -72.2711
The South Cemetery is located in Cheshire County<1>.
The county seat for Cheshire County is located in Keene. Keene lies 13 miles [20.9 km]<2> to the north of the South Cemetery .

- Note: In 2021, GNIS record #870026 was archived by the USGS. It is no longer maintained by the USGS, nor can it be retrieved from their website. In the past, the GNIS record contained the following information:
- BGN Class: cemetery
- County: Cheshire
- Est. Elev: 333 (in feet)
- Topo Map Name: Mount Grace
- Location given for South Cemetery:
- Lat: 42.7434172 Lon: -72.272029
